Assessment of the Efficacy of Vitamin D-fortified Oil in Healthy Adults

The aim of this study is to evaluate the efficacy of daily intake of fortified sunflower oil with vitamin D on serum 25-hydroxyvitamin D level, glycemic and lipidemic status in healthy subjects compared to plain oil.

About this study

Sixty apparently healthy subjects will be selected. Participants who are receiving vitamin D, calcium or omega-3 supplements within the last three months will be excluded. Subjects will be assigned randomly to one of the two intervention groups: 1.fortified sunflower oil, 2. plain bread+vitamin D supplements,3. plain bread+placebo. Each participant will consume 50 g of oil every day for 2 months.

At the first and last visits, dietary and laboratory assessments will be performed for all subjects. Primary outcomes are the improvement in vitamin D status and secondary outcome is the improvement of glycemic and lipidemic markers and prevention of problems related to hypovitaminosis D.
